Product Description:
Creating the characters for a puppet show is as easy as 1-2-3! Punch out these critters, fold along the lines, assemble them with glue or tape, and voilà! A cast of friendly animals is ready to roar, growl, and laugh. Sixteen enchanting puppets include a tiger, zebra, elephant, lion, monkey, hippo, gorilla, panda, and more. Fun for all ages, the puppets will especially appeal to 7- to 10-year-olds.
